Legal Notice

Business Name
ShazamHub
Address
A-37A, Kewal Park Extn, Delhi, 110033, India
Registered Company Name
ShazamHub
Phone Number
+919716393381
Registered Office Address
A-37A, Kewal Park Extn Delhi 110033